A Fast Quasi-3D Finite-Element Beam Propagation Method in Time Domain

Not Accessible

Your library or personal account may give you access

Abstract

A fast quasi-3D finite-element beam propagation method in time domain is presented, which can give the equivalent 2D structure from a 3D optical waveguide using spectral index method. This method is verified through simulating optical waveguide grating and ring resonator. The results have good agreement with those by FDTD method.
